WebThe Brokpa are ethnically distinct from other Bhutanese, having migrated through the Himalayas from the Tshoona region of Tibet a few centuries ago. Traditions and culture passed down over the ages still play a central role in their social life. WebThe Brokpa people are semi-nomadic yak herders who have lived largely in isolation since arriving to Bhutan. Several of their villages, like Sakteng, Tengma, and Borang Tse, still have no road access today. …
